/*
 * USER_MODULE_CUTOVER_FLAG
 *
 * This constant gates traffic between the legacy Ironvale monolith's
 * user module and the new Accountsmith service during the split.
 * Do not remove it until the migration working group confirms all
 * tenants have been moved and the shadow-write comparison has run
 * clean for thirty days. Context lives on the Accountsmith wiki.
 * The build in which this flag was introduced is identified by the
 * token recorded below.
 */

build token for kagaf-hahof: htk14_9d3d4d26d7d8de

Subject: Key rotation for SplitGate assignment service

Hello plugin authors,

As part of our quarterly security cycle, the API keys for SplitGate, our A/B experiment assignment service, will rotate this Friday. Existing keys stop working at cutover; there is no overlap window this time, so please update your plugin configuration before then. Assignment payloads, bucketing logic, and endpoints are unchanged — only the credential differs. Use the new key below for all SplitGate calls going forward.

service key, fawip-bajef: kto11_Qt5wZK9vdNC

- [ ] Floor 6 of Marrowgate House opens to staff this week. Facilities desk: confirm the new starter's workstation assignment, locker number, and fire-warden briefing before escorting them up. The lift currently stops at Floor 5 only; use Stairwell C to reach Floor 6 until the lift programming is finished. The stairwell door is on a temporary keypad rather than the badge system. Issue the starter the interim door code below.

door code, bagef-yafop: bdg-ZFZML-07646

The garage occupancy feed for the Brindlewood campus arrives over a message queue every thirty seconds, one record per level, published by the Stallgrid edge boxes. Counts can briefly go negative when a sensor double-fires on exit; the ingest job clamps these to zero and flags the interval. If the feed stalls for more than five minutes, the dashboard falls back to the last known snapshot. Sensor mappings, queue names, and the replay procedure are documented on the internal page below.

runbook for tahog-kadug: https://gitlab.qirvanworks.corp/projects/pages/view/b139298aed28